The smart home is now an established area of interest and research that contributes to comfort in modern homes. With the Internet being an essential part of broad communication in modern life, IoT has allowed homes to go beyond building to interactive abodes. In many spheres of human life, the IoT has grown exponentially, including monitoring ecological factors, controlling the home and its appliances, and storing data generated by devices in the house in the cloud. Smart home includes multiple components, technologies, and devices that generate valuable data for predicting home and environment activities. This work presents the design and development of a ubiquitous, cloud-based intelligent home automation system. The system controls, monitors, and oversees the security of a home and its environment via an Android mobile application. One module controls and monitors electrical appliances and environmental factors, while another module oversees the home’s security by detecting motion and capturing images. Our work uses a camera to capture images of objects triggered by their motion being detected. To avoid false alarms, we used the concept of machine learning to differentiate between images of regular home occupants and those of an intruder. The support vector machine algorithm is proposed in this study to classify the features of the image captured and determine if it is that of a regular home occupant or an intruder before sending an alarm to the user. The design of the mobile application allows a graphical display of the activities in the house. Our work proves that machine learning algorithms can improve home automation system functionality and enhance home security. The work’s prototype was implemented using an ESP8266 board, an ESP32-CAM board, a 5 V four-channel relay module, and sensors.

The smart home automation system is designed to conveniently manage and monitor household appliances and lighting fixtures remotely, to save time and to use resources effectively. It is a control system for allowing access to home automation devices. The automation devices include lights, fan, camera and doors. It even enhances the main features of the project to control the home appliances from anywhere as remotely. With the camera module, continuous surveillance and protection of the home is accomplished. A significant improvement is achieved in utility costs by an optimal use of energy. Using inexpensive electronic and interactive tools, this initiative can be applied, making it economically, physically and operationally feasible. Basically it involves controlling everything remotely via a visual interface and mobile application. The automation system employs the use of MQTT protocol in order to secure the transmitted device based information to and from in the network. The defense against Man in the Middle attack (MITM) is the main focus of our automation system. The routed messages are checked at the intermediate hub to check for the occurrence of MITM based DoS attacks through manual reset points. .

With the rapid growth in technology, which is improving every day and becoming more pervasive, smartphone users also are increasing. These intelligent devices and gadgets are now being used in automated vehicles, IoT enabled industries, surveillance, education, entertainment, etc. Android, Linux kernel based mobile operating system, with its largest market share is now being used in almost every device that is capable to do some computation. These devices may include smartwatches, digital cameras, smart glasses, smart mirrors, Home Automation System (HAS), Internet of Things (IoT), Internet of Vehicles (IoV), and many more. Parallel to these developments, the android based systems also are being targeted by the cyber attacker by developing more advanced malwares. Such attacks may harm to the system as well as human life. The android malwares are evolving day by day and are capable to escape the traditional security solutions. Therefore, security is the primary issue of android based system, which requires to be re-investigated. In this paper, we analyze the pertinence of machine learning based solutions to detect android malware, particularly Adware. Logistic Regression (LR), Linear Discriminant Analysis (LDA), K-Nearest Neighbors (KNN), Classification And Regression Trees (CART), and Naive Bayes (NB) machine-learning algorithms are trained and tested for two scenarios. Scenario A for binary classification and Scenario B is for multi-class classification. The 60% of the dataset is used to train the ML algorithms and the remaining 40% is reserved for the testing. The algorithms are evaluated by using 10-fold crossvalidation method.
